在JSP开发过程中,表格数据的分页展示是一个非常实用的功能。它可以帮助用户在浏览大量数据时,只显示当前页面的数据,从而提高页面性能和用户体验。本文将详细介绍如何使用JSP实现表格数据的分页展示,并通过一个具体的实例来演示如何使用省略号来展示分页信息。
1. 基本概念
在实现表格数据分页展示之前,我们需要了解一些基本概念:
- 总记录数:数据库中所有记录的总数。
- 每页显示记录数:每页显示的记录数,通常是一个可配置的参数。
- 当前页码:用户当前所在的页码。
- 总页数:根据总记录数和每页显示记录数计算得出的总页数。
2. 数据库查询
为了实现分页展示,我们需要从数据库中查询当前页的数据。以下是一个简单的SQL查询语句,用于查询当前页的数据:
```sql
SELECT * FROM table_name
LIMIT start, end;
```
其中,`start` 表示当前页码减去1再乘以每页显示记录数,`end` 表示当前页码乘以每页显示记录数。
3. JSP页面实现
接下来,我们将通过一个JSP页面来实现表格数据的分页展示。
3.1 页面布局
我们需要设计一个简单的HTML表格布局,用于展示数据。以下是一个简单的表格布局示例:
```html
| 列1 | 列2 | 列3 |
|---|
```
3.2 数据展示
接下来,我们需要使用JSP标签和EL表达式来展示数据。以下是一个简单的数据展示示例:
```jsp
<%@ page language="